Which type of discipline involves communicating expectations and engaging in joint problem-solving?

  1. Counseling

  2. Progressive

  3. Positive

  4. Mentoring

The correct answer is: Positive

Positive discipline involves setting expectations and enforcing boundaries while maintaining a connection and avoiding punishment or blame. Counseling typically involves a one-sided conversation where a trained professional advises a person on how to improve their behavior. Progressive discipline is a hierarchical system of providing consequences for breaking rules. Mentoring is a supportive relationship between a more experienced person and a less experienced person, but it does not necessarily involve problem-solving or setting expectations. Therefore, option C, positive discipline, is the most appropriate type of discipline for communicating expectations and engaging in joint problem-solving.
